单片机外围器件实用手册

单片机外围器件实用手册 pdf epub mobi txt 电子书 下载 2026

出版者:北京航大
作者:窦振中
出品人:
页数:572
译者:
出版时间:2000-10-1
价格:55.00
装帧:平装(无盘)
isbn号码:9787810127264
丛书系列:
图书标签:
  • 单片机
  • 外围器件
  • 嵌入式系统
  • 硬件设计
  • 电子工程
  • 实用手册
  • STC
  • AVR
  • ARM
  • 开发板
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

单片机外围器件实用手册,ISBN:9787810127264,作者:窦振中编著

好的,以下是为您编写的、不包含“单片机外围器件实用手册”内容的图书简介,侧重于其他技术领域,力求详实且自然流畅。 --- 图书简介:嵌入式系统架构设计与高级应用 数字化时代的基石:深入理解现代嵌入式系统的核心原理与实践 在当前快速迭代的科技浪潮中,嵌入式系统已不再是简单的“小工具”,而是驱动从消费电子到工业自动化、从智能医疗到航空航天等各个领域的核心引擎。《嵌入式系统架构设计与高级应用》正是一本旨在帮助读者跨越理论与实践鸿沟、全面掌握现代嵌入式系统从概念构思到高效实现的专业指南。本书跳脱出对单一微控制器或外设的机械式罗列,而是聚焦于系统层面的整合、优化与复杂性管理。 第一部分:现代嵌入式系统设计哲学与架构选择 本书的开篇着眼于宏观的设计哲学。我们首先探讨了在不同应用场景下,如何进行恰当的硬件选型与架构评估。这不仅仅是关于选择CPU的主频或缓存大小,更重要的是理解RISC-V、ARM Cortex-M/R/A系列等主流指令集架构(ISA)的内在差异及其对功耗、实时性、安全性的影响。 我们将详细剖析分层架构设计的艺术。在复杂的系统中,清晰的层次划分是成功的关键。本书会深入讲解如何构建健壮的硬件抽象层(HAL)、驱动层、中间件层以及应用层,确保代码的可移植性、可维护性和模块化。重点讨论了面向对象设计(OOD)在嵌入式环境中的应用,以及如何使用设计模式(如观察者模式、状态机模式)来管理复杂的并发和事件流。 第二部分:实时操作系统(RTOS)的深度剖析与性能调优 对于需要严格时间约束的系统,实时操作系统是不可或缺的支柱。本书不会停留在RTOS API的表面介绍,而是深入探讨内核调度算法的内在机制。我们将对比经典的固定优先级抢占式调度与更复杂的优先级继承/优先级天花板协议(用于解决优先级反转问题),并结合FreeRTOS、Zephyr等主流开源RTOS的源码结构进行实例解析。 性能调优是本书的重点环节。我们讲解如何使用钩子函数(Hooks)来追踪系统开销,如何精确测量任务切换延迟和中断延迟。此外,对于需要极低延迟的控制环路,本书提供了时间触发型调度(TT调度)的实现思路,以及如何利用硬件定时器和DMA(直接内存访问)来卸载CPU,从而实现更高效的并行处理。 第三部分:系统级互联与通信协议栈的实现 现代嵌入式设备几乎无一例外地需要与外部世界进行数据交换。本书花费大量篇幅讲解高级通信协议栈的实现与优化。 在有线通信方面,我们不仅覆盖了基础的UART、SPI、I2C,更侧重于工业现场总线如CAN FD(含错误检测与容错机制)的配置与应用,以及高速串行通信(如PCIe基础概念)在高性能嵌入式处理平台上的作用。 在无线连接方面,本书着重于面向物联网(IoT)的通信协议。我们详细解析了TCP/IP协议栈在资源受限设备上的裁剪与优化,例如如何使用LwIP进行内存管理,如何实现IPv6的低功耗扩展(6LoWPAN)。对于非IP类物联网连接,MQTT、CoAP协议的语义理解、QoS等级的权衡,以及如何结合TLS/DTLS进行端到端安全传输,都提供了详尽的实战指南。 第四部分:嵌入式系统的高级安全与可靠性设计 随着设备联网,安全问题日益突出。本书将安全视为系统架构的内在组成部分,而非事后补救措施。我们将探讨信任根(Root of Trust, RoT)的概念,以及如何在启动流程中建立安全链。 内容覆盖硬件安全模块(HSM)的应用,如密钥存储、随机数生成器(TRNG/PRNG)的使用规范。对于软件层面,我们将介绍内存保护单元(MPU)和内存管理单元(MMU)的配置,以实现任务隔离,防止恶意代码或错误代码破坏关键数据。此外,还涉及安全启动(Secure Boot)的原理,以及如何使用数字签名验证固件的完整性。 在可靠性方面,本书讲解了冗余设计、故障注入测试(Fault Injection Testing)的基础方法,以及如何设计看门狗(Watchdog)电路和软件算法,以应对瞬时硬件故障或软件死锁。 第五部分:嵌入式系统的高效调试、测试与持续集成 再好的设计,也需要严谨的验证。本书最后一部分聚焦于提升开发效率和产品质量的工程实践。 调试方面,重点在于硬件调试接口(如SWD/JTAG)的高级用法,包括断点管理、跟踪缓冲区(Trace Buffer)的使用,以及如何利用逻辑分析仪和示波器来观察和验证时序敏感的交互信号。 测试方面,我们强调单元测试和集成测试在嵌入式环境中的落地。介绍如何使用Cmocka或类似框架在主机端模拟硬件行为,对驱动和中间件代码进行白盒测试。更进一步,我们探讨了硬件在环(HIL)仿真测试平台的构建思路,以及如何自动化回归测试流程。 持续集成/持续部署(CI/CD)在嵌入式开发中的应用,如使用Gitlab CI或Jenkins自动化固件的编译、静态代码分析(Linting)和部署流程,以确保代码质量的持续提升。 --- 本书的目标读者群包括:有一定C/C++基础,希望从基础的单片机编程晋升到复杂嵌入式软件和系统架构设计的工程师、电子信息工程专业的高年级学生及研究生,以及希望系统性地更新自己嵌入式技术栈的资深开发者。通过本书的学习,读者将能够自信地驾驭复杂多变的现代嵌入式项目,设计出高性能、高可靠、高安全的智能系统。

作者简介

目录信息

前言
绪论
使用符号说明
使用略缩语说明
第一章 易失性存储器
第二章 非易失性存储器
第三章 多端口读写存储器MPRAM
第四章 内嵌电池掉电自保护存储器插座
第五章 微控制器片内存储器
第六章 存储器应用技术
参考文献
附录 国内外生产半导体存储器器件公司和代理商名录
· · · · · · (收起)

读后感

评分

评分

评分

评分

评分

用户评价

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有